Just getting into mod'ing a warrior to enhance performance...looking at

K&N Filter
Dyno Jet Kit

and a Pipe...anyone have any recommendations or experiences with piping a warrior. Looking for good solid performance gain without it being TOO loud...dont mind it louder just not outrageous...looking at a White Bro E Series or a FMF brand...and insight or feedback here ... thanks

The Yoshimura is supposed to be the quietest of the performance pipes but puts out good power. It also looks good. I have a Big Gun Race Series and it's loud, but I like that.
